Basic scenario we all know: Super Bowl grid pool of 10 squares by 10 squares with the numbers 0-9 on each axis randomly selected. For this question, I am talking about before the numbers for the axes are even drawn, so just a 10 x 10 square pool. What is the expected value of your bet net of your initial cash outlay?
For simplicity, assume it is $5 per square for a total pot for $500.
My contention is that, regardless of how many squares you buy, the net expected value is zero; an example of buying one ticket:
-5 + 500*(1/100) = 0
One of my coworkers vehemently disagrees saying it is:
-5*(99/100) + 500*(1/100) = 0.05
I think he is wrong, please halp!
